The Open Automatic Speech Recognition (ASR) Leaderboard ranks and compares various speech recognition systems. It offers researchers and developers a way to gauge model performance and track progress in the field. TL;DR The text says the leaderboard now includes multilingual and long-form speech tracks to reflect diverse language use and extended speech scenarios. The article reports that advanced neural network systems generally perform better, though challenges remain across languages and long speech segments. Ethical issues such as privacy and bias are noted as important considerations alongside technical improvements. Role of the Open ASR Leaderboard The leaderboard functions as a benchmark platform, helping to clarify the current state of speech recognition technology.
